Short in CAN Communication Line Inspection

WARNING: This page is about a different variant/trim than selected.
  1. Ignition "ON".
  2. Measure voltage between Pin No. 3 (C-CAN High) terminal of Data Link Connector (DLC) and chassis ground.
  3. Measure voltage between Pin No. 11 (C-CAN Low) terminal of Data Link Connector (DLC) and chassis ground.

    Specification:  CAN High Voltage - Approx. 3.28V/CAN Low Voltage - Approx. 1.87V

  4. Is measured value within specification?

    YES 

    • Fault might be intermittent and caused either by poor contact in connectors or wiring harness, or it has been repaired and control module memory is not cleared yet. Thoroughly check terminal of battery, all connectors (and connections) for looseness, bending, corrosion, contamination, deterioration, and/or damage.
    • Repair or replace as necessary and then go to "VERIFICATION OF VEHICLE REPAIR " procedure.

    NO 

    • Go to next procedure.
  5. Ignition "OFF".
  6. Disconnect Battery (-) terminal.
  7. Refer to "appropriate service information" and disconnect Cluster, ECM, TCM, HECU and other control unit connector that connected to C-CAN Communication circuit.
  8. Measure resistance between Pin No. 3 (C-CAN High) terminal and Pin No. 11 (C-CAN Low) terminal of Data Link Connector (DLC).

    Specification:  Infinite (∞ (infinite)) Ω

  9. Is measured value within specification?
